| AAK900, chassis No. PB0262 is a 1935 MG PB 2-seater, register No. 2334, dark green cellulose finish. Original 939cc engine, No. 5112APB with Scintilla Vertex magneto ignition. Delivered from the factory 31 August 1935, sold by Waterhouse and Son, Bradford, thought to be modified for competition by Naylor, Bradford. Some competition history in supercharged form in 1936 Welsh Rally, drivers Naylor and Onslow-Bartlett, and 1936 Scottish Rally, drivers Welch and Naylor. Some documentation, rally plate, signed route book and photos included. Present owner from 1954. Converted to twin SU carburettors. Matching numbers against dispatch form for engine and rear axle. Different gearbox case fitted but original case included in sale. Engine re-built in 1958. Run until 1961 when put into dry storage. Re-commissioned and returned to the road in 2011. Engine re-built, wheels re-built, battery re-built, new fuel tank, new trim and new Collingburn leather seats. All other bodywork is original, repaired and re-painted as required. Brakes re-lined in 2018 when broken hip prevented any further driving. Stored in a dry garage and maintained in running condition. Complete record of all maintenance and work since 1954. Car is comprehensively insured and has road tax as historic vehicle and could be driven on road for trial. Brakes require bedding in. Car is in authentic 1935 condition with modifications from that era and sympathetic restoration. Assorted spare parts and extra 19” wheel included.
As featured in MG Safety Fast Magazine, December 2014.
